The Japanese are abuzz over the arrest of “Rurouni Kenshin” creator Nobuhiro Watsuki on the charge of possessing child pornography. Tokyo Metropolitan Police found the DVDs after Watsuki came upon their radar once they were tipped on a different investigation. By continuing, you are agreeing to our use of cookies. Rurouni Kenshin tells the story of a former assassin named Kenshin Himura who has dedicated his life to atoning his past sins.

Tokyo police found DVDs of unclothed girls in their early teens in Watsuki’s possession. It's all over the news in Japan. Currently, a guilty plea to such a crime can lead to up to one year of prison and a maximum fine of 1 million yen. ), celebrities, video games, doramas, anime and everything else in between.
